Odessa and Germany: Strengthening Collaborative Efforts
The Mayor of Odessa, Hennadiy Trukhanov, met with German politician Ralph Fuchs and Mari Luise Beck, the director for Eastern and Central Europe.
During the meeting, they discussed the current security and humanitarian situation in Odessa, the status of internally displaced persons, and international cooperation.
Energy issues and preparations for the upcoming heating season were also on the agenda.
In collaboration with the Centre for Liberal Modernity and the German GIZ agency, a project for the improvement of the "Against Oblivion" park is underway in Odessa. However, due to the ongoing war, the project has been paused, and the funds provided by German partners have been redirected to civilian needs, including generators and medical supplies.
The agency also delivered humanitarian aid to Odessa, including ambulances, pickups, and rescue kits.
Odessa expresses its gratitude to the German partners for their ongoing support.
